Gary Neville does not expect Cristiano Ronaldo to replace Harry Maguire as Manchester United captain despite his emotional return to the club this week.Ronaldo, 36, has secured a £20million move back to United 12 years after departing to join Real Madrid, calling time on his stay at Juventus to pen a two-year deal with Ole Gunnar Solskjaer's side.The Portugal captain has cemented a legacy as one of the greatest players of all time since waving goodbye to Old Trafford in 2009, winning another four Ballon d'Ors and as many Champions Leagues at Madrid before heading to Juve.Now he is a Red Devils player once more after snubbing interest from neighbours Manchester City to re-sign for the club, a move which boosts their chances of winning the.
